You should configure it as a regular serial interface. Since you don't need outbound dialing, you

don't need DDR (unless you want to specify interesting traffic for an idle timer, then you would need DDR). So configure an address, the encapsulation, and that should be sufficient.

From the cisco's perspective, this should be just another serial interface - ie, when DCD goes

high, we will declare the line and line protocol up and attempt to negotiate PPP. If the negotiation fails, the line protocol will go down. You may want to ensure that the TA raises DCD once a call is received, it may only raise DSR.

You may want to troubleshoot this with

debug serial interface

debug ppp negot

If you get no response from the TA, then you should confirm it's config to see that it is configured to answer calls. With DTR up, the TA should be answering calls. The TA

needs to answer the call before the cisco can do anything.
